From the Wall Street Journal:
“WASHINGTON — U.S. prosecutors plan criminal trials for five men accused of orchestrating the Sept. 11, 2001, terror attacks, and military tribunals for five others held at the Guantanamo Bay prison.
Khalid Sheikh Mohammed, self-described mastermind of the attacks, and four others will be tried in New York federal court. Attorney General Eric Holder said Friday he expects to order prosecutors to seek the death penalty in the five cases.”via online.wsj.com

President Barack Obama called Walter Cronkite “a voice of certainty in a world that was growing more and more uncertain.”
Speaking at a memorial service for the legendary newsman, Obama acknowledged he hadn’t known Cronkite personally, “but I have benefited as a citizen from his dogged pursuit of the truth.”
“But if we realize that the kind of journalism he embodied will not simply rekindle itself as part of the natural cycle, but will come alive only if we stand up and demand it,” Obama said he was convinced “the golden days of journalism still lie ahead.”

Senator Ted “Edward”Kennedy Funeral update- There will be only Four of Five Living Presidents at the Ted Kennedy Funeral Mass on Saturday. Reports state that Bush 41, George H W Bush will not able to make the trip.
“A spokesman for Bush said Friday that he and his wife, Barbara, decided not to attend Kennedy’s funeral after learning their son, former President George W. Bush, would attend.
Jim McGrath says the 85-year-old Bush feels his son’s presence would “amply and well represent” the family Saturday.”

Senator Edward Kennedy a one time candidate for..President will have a funeral mass in Boston on Saturday August 3oth 2009. All living Presidents will be present in Boston for the the Funeral mass. Edward Kennedy was several times a candidate for President of the United States.
Political Analysts say that because of the Chappaquiddick incident in 1969, he was never able to realize Presidential Office. Instead he is now eulogized as the lion of the United States Senate.
President Obama will give a Eulogy at the Funeral Mass.
